Crocheted Checkerboard Pillow Pattern

Abbreviations
ch - chain
sp - space
sc - single crochet
RSC - Reverse Single Crochet

Materials & Supplies
9 oz Burgundy worsted weight yarn
8 oz Cornmeal worsted weight yarn
Size “J” crochet hook
Tapestry needle
14" Pillow form or polyester fiberfill to stuff

Directions:

Strip A: (make 6)
Row 1: With Cornmeal, ch 10, sc in second ch from hook and in each ch across, ch 1, turn

Rows 2-8: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 9: Sc in each sc across, change to Burgundy, ch 1, turn

Rows 10-17: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 18: Sc in each Sc across, change to Cornmeal, ch 1, turn

Row 19-26: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 27: Sc in each sc across, change to Burgundy, ch 1, turn

Rows 28-35: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 36: Sc in each sc across, change to Cornmeal, ch 1, turn

Rows 37-44: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 45: Sc in each sc across, finish off, weave in loose ends.

Strip B: (make 4)
Row 1: With Burgundy, ch 10, sc in second ch from hook and in each ch across, ch 1, turn

Rows 2-8: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 9: Sc in each sc across, change to Cornmeal, ch 1, turn

Rows 10-17: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 18: Sc in each Sc across, change to Burgundy, ch 1, turn

Row 19-26: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 27: Sc in each sc across, change to Cornmeal, ch 1, turn

Rows 28-35: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 36: Sc in each sc across, change to Burgundy, ch 1, turn

Rows 37-44: Sc in each sc across, ch 1, turn

Row 45: Sc in each sc across, finish off, weave in loose ends.

Panel Assembly
Pillow is constructed of two panels (one for the front, one for the backside) using 3 of Strip A and 2 of Strip B for each panel. Strips are whipstitched together lengthwise as shown below:



Pillow Assembly and Border:
Rnd 1: Place the two completed panels wrong sides together. With Burgundy yarn and working through both thicknesses, sc two panels together along three sides. Make sure to keep the checker squares lined up. Insert pillow form (or stuff with polyester fiberfill), sc fourth side closed, ch 1, turn.

Rnd 2: Sc in each sc around working 3 sc in corners, ch 1, turn

Rnd 3: RSC in each sc around working 3 RSC in corners, finish off, weave in loose ends.
